Omena is appropriate for chicken because it is nutrient-and fat-rich. Omena is a naturally occurring protein that promotes growth, bone health, and the development of a robust immune system. You can feed omena to chickens to promote healthy growth. In contrast, the quality of omena degrades when stored in hot weather. In addition, contamination with omena at concentrations above 9 percent will have a greater impact on the eggs and meat of contaminated birds. In place of omena, ochonga may be substituted.

Ochonga Price

Many farmers have supplemented omena with ochonga. Ochonga’s price is usually Ksh. 90 per kg and Ksh. 50 per gorogoro. Omena is quite more expensive than ochonga, and it goes for Ksh. 130 per kilogram as well as Ksh. 130 per gorogoro. Ochonga is readily available in markets near you.

Ochonga Protein Content

Ochonga contains 70% of the protein content. Ochonga is also rich in amino acids, vitamins, and minerals necessary to grow and build strong immunity. Therefore, it is recommended to feed your hens with ochonga due to their rich nutritional content.

Is Fish Feed Good for Chickens?

Fish feed is good for chicken since it is a good source of protein for poultry. It contains amino acids such as methionine and lysine, a good balance of unsaturated fatty acids, vitamins, and minerals. They help birds gain the required weight that fetches maximum profits in the market.
